
Augmented Reality Games (ARGs) are interactive experiences that blend real-world elements with virtual components, creating immersive narratives across multiple media platforms. In the Web3 environment, ARG games leverage blockchain technology to enable digital asset ownership, cross-platform interoperability, and enhanced player autonomy, becoming an integral component of the metaverse ecosystem. These games extend beyond traditional screens, expanding gameplay into the real world and encouraging players to progress through puzzle-solving, social collaboration, and physical exploration.

ARGs typically lack obvious game boundaries, instead guiding players into the narrative through "rabbit hole" entry points and advancing the story via clues scattered across different channels (websites, social media, physical locations), creating a "This Is Not A Game" (TINAG) immersive experience.
